  1. To Encourage Seminary Specialized Witness and Outreach Training
  2. RESOLUTION 6-02
  3. Reports R13.1–2 (CW, 64–67); Overture 6-58 (CW, 399)
  4. WHEREAS, God “desires all people to be saved and to come to the knowledge of the truth” (1 Tim. 2:4), and the Lord
  5. Jesus is the “light for revelation to the Gentiles and for glory to [His] people Israel” (Luke 2:32); and
  6. WHEREAS, The seminaries of the Synod have faithfully served God’s Church, providing pastors who proclaim God’s
  7. Word and administer the Sacraments since 1839; and
  8. WHEREAS, The seminaries have throughout their history provided training for men who served the church in
  9. specialized areas of outreach ministry such as church planting, foreign and domestic missions, etc.; and
  10. WHEREAS, The seminaries are actively enhancing formation to embrace mission, witness, and outreach in response to
  11. the 2023 Res. 1-01A, “To Stimulate Training for Witness” (Proc., 115), which was adopted by unanimous voice vote;
  12. therefore be it
  13. Resolved, That we offer our thanks for the additional coursework and workshops in evangelism and outreach; and be
  14. it further
  15. Resolved, That the Synod in convention request that the seminaries, in consultation with the Council of Presidents,
  16. identify specialized areas of seminary training that are needed today in the life of the church and its mission to the world,
  17. including the preparation of men for church planting.
